After your loved one passes,

If your loved one does not pass in a healthcare facility, someone will need to contact emergency personnel before they can be brought to us. Once this has been done and you are ready, the personnel will contact the funeral home and we will prepare to take your loved one into our care.


If your loved one does pass in a healthcare facility, they will notify the family and ensure you have the chance to say goodbye. Every facility has a different process, but the majority will not contact the funeral home until you have confirmed that it is okay for the loved one to be picked up.


We know this transition is difficult and we understand that you need that time to grieve the loss of your loved one. 

Before we meet,

Once you have scheduled your meeting with us, there will be a form to fill out to prepare for your loved ones services. This form will include personalized questions and information catered to your loved one in order to make the services unique to them.


Here is a list of important things to have prepared:

  • Full Name
  • Social Security Number
  • Date & Place of Birth
  • Parent’s Names
  • Education and occupation information
  • Clergy information
  • Insurance policy information
  • Unique hobbies and interests
  • Have life insurance and Veteran discharge papers (if applicable)


Make sure to consider the details of your loved one’s funeral such as the casket or urn, travel arrangements, flowers, who may be speaking at the services, etc. We will remind you of these things when we first meet. 


During our meeting,

There are specific steps that you can take to make sure the services are personalized to fit your loved one. These are the things we will go over when we meet at the funeral home. 


  • Prepare the death certificate
  • Where the services/events will be held
  • Cremation or burial
  • Pallbearers (if applicable)
  • Drafting an obituary
  • Specific photo and preferred clothing to dress your loved one in
  • Paying for the services
